>  Thanks for your insightful comments on this issue. I think I can summarize 
> the discussions on this issue to the following:
>
> 1. Folks are seeing limitations in the version of commons-feedparser (0.6) 
> used by parse-rss in the Nutch trunk
> 2. There are alternatives to feedparser in the form of ROME, informa, abdera, 
> etc.
> 3. There is a newer, maintained version of Kevin Burton's feed parser that 
> alleviates some of the limitations of feedparser (0.6) used in the Nutch trunk
> 4. We shouldn't be developing our own feedparsing solution

I have been using ROME lately and it has a really nice feature:
Modules. With the necessary modules installed, ROME can extract iTunes
podcast, MediaRSS, etc. information from feeds. So it is also very
useful to build a video/audio search engine. I haven't looked into
feedparser in detail but it doesn't seem to have that. So ROME has as
big plus here for me.

Anyway, if the decision is to write an abstraction layer, I think
RSSChannel and RSSItem classes (with an extra metadata field) will
provide a good starting point.

> > As discussed by Nutch Newbie, Gal, and Chris on NUTCH-443, the current 
> > library (feedparser) has the following issues:
> > - OutOfMemory when parsing > 100k feeds, since it has to convert the feed 
> > to jdom first
> > - no support for Atom 1.0
> > - there has been no development in the last year
> > Alternatives are:
> > - Rome
> > - Informa
> > - custom implementation based on Stax
> > - ??
